Private Sub Document_Open()
Dim TextLine
Dim k As Byte ' Счетчик строк в текстовом файле
Dim l As Integer ' Счетчик максимальной длины записи в ComboBox
k = 1
l = 0
Open "text1.txt" For Input As #1 ' Open file.
Do While Not EOF(1) ' Loop until end of file.
Line Input #1, TextLine ' Read line into variable.
ComboBox1.AddItem TextLine, k - 1
If Len(TextLine) > l Then l = Len(TextLine)
k = k + 1
Loop
ComboBox1.ColumnWidths = l * 4.5
Close #1 ' Close file.
End Sub
Dim R0 As Long
R0 = 1
Do Until IsEmpty(ActiveWorkbook.Sheets("Sheet1").Cells(R,1).Value
Combo1.AddItem ActiveWorkbook.Sheets("Sheet1").Cells(R,1).Text
R = R + 1
Loop
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 76